Journey to starting GreenBytes an Eco-Startup in Iceland: Jillian Verbeurgt

Journey to starting GreenBytes an Eco-Startup in Iceland: Jillian Verbeurgt

Introducing Jillian Verbeurgt !

A Canadian American currently residing in Reykjavik, Iceland, and has been the co-founder of a GreenTech startup called GreenBytes! GreenBytes started off as a service to a platform that tackles the ever-growing challenges of the world's food waste.

We will follow her journey from studying to be a GeoPhysicist in British Columbia to become a leader in Iceland's eco-friendly tech sector. With an unquenchable curiosity, she dived into the world of archaeology partly due to the ole Indiana Jones and his series of onscreen adventures. She realized during her studies she actually loved physics and did a quick pivot! She earned a Geophysics degree from the University of Calgary where she also partook in some universities traditions that include but not limited to Couch Surfing ( literally) down snow-covered hills.

After some economic downturn in her neighborhood, she looked at her options to pursue a Master's degree at the Iceland School of Energy with a focus on Sustainable Energy. This led to her new life in Iceland, meeting a previous guest and good friend Renata Bade, and co-founding a startup to answer some really difficult questions.

How by taking on new challenges, not sweating the small stuff, and thinking about the big picture, Jillian took many turns that didn't follow the traditional career path. She discovered a new way to work and how that work would leave an impact.

Journey to Augment Health : Jared Meyers

Journey to Augment Health : Jared Meyers

This is Jared Meyers, the co-founder and fearless leader of Augment Health, a medical device startup that allows users to safely and comfortably monitor their bladder fill in order to restore freedom and independence. 

He is currently a senior at Georgia Tech pursuing his Biomedical engineering Bachelors degree. He started life with multiple allergies one being allergic to peas and also suffered an ACL injury during his high school soccer career. These moments in life allowed him to really think about what he wanted to do and why.  His perspective was forever changed to solving problems and not just any problems, problems associated with one's health. 

Jared learned to use multiple productivity tools and tips such as putting everything he does on a calendar and time boxing specific tasks so he can focus on one thing at a time. Apparently, the easiest way his girlfriend could get a hold of him is to schedule herself on the calendar. 

We dived deep into his favorite way to psych himself up which is blasting either Eminem's 8 miles or Hamilton the Musical's My Shot!
